Official Biography

Chief Warrant Officer 2 Mardia A. Tompo
Director
3rd Marine Aircraft Wing Band

Chief Warrant Officer 2 Mardia Tompo currently serves as director of the 3rd Marine Aircraft Wing Band. In this capacity she serves as the officer in charge and manages, administers, and coordinates musical performances, develops budgets and annual operation plans, directs internal operations and training, and supervises the employment of a Marine Corps fleet band.

Chief Warrant Officer 2 Tompo enlisted in the U.S. Marine Corps in 2009 and completed Recruit Training at Marine Corps Recruit Depot Parris Island, South Carolina and Marine Combat Training at Camp Lejeune, North Carolina. She completed the Basic Music Course in 2010 at the Naval School of Music in Virginia Beach, Virginia.

Chief Warrant Officer 2 Tompo served as a clarinet instrumentalist in the following fleet Marine band: III Marine Expeditionary Force Band (2010-2014). As do all fleet Marine musicians, Chief Warrant Officer 2 Tompo served in a variety of music, collateral duty, and leadership roles, to include platoon leadership.

Chief Warrant Officer 2 Tompo served as an instructor at the Naval School of Music (2014-2018) and a musician technical assistant with 6th Marine Corps District (2019-2022).

Chief Warrant Officer 2 Tompo was appointed a warrant officer and graduated from The Basic School in 2023 and served as director of the Parris Island Marine Band (2023-2025).

Chief Warrant Officer 2 Tompo attended the Unit Leader Course (2014) and the Senior Musician Course (2018) and is a graduate of the Basic Recruiter Course (2019). Chief Warrant Officer 2 Tompo was the Marine Musician of the Year (2015) and the Junior Instructor of the Year for the Navy Center of Service Support and Marine Corps Intelligence Schools (2016). Her awards include the Navy and Marine Corps Commendation Medal (4th award) and the Navy and Marine Corps Achievement Medal (2nd award).
